WebYou can’t write an effective, compliant privacy notice without really thinking about, discussing and writing a few things down first. You need to have mapped your data flows . These show in a visual format the way personal data is collected, stored, used and shared by your organisation. You then need to use these data flows to create a Record ... WebThe DPA acknowledged that the right to conduct a business enshrined in Article 16 of the EU Charter was relevant. However, an appropriate balance between this fundamental right and data protection was excluded by the fact the controller did not even consider the implications of the granularity principle.
